Florida Family Court requires divorcing/separating couples with minor children to complete a DCF approved parenting class before finalizing their divorce.

I'm a bilingual (Spanish) Florida licensed Mental Health Counselor with over 11 years of experience working with individuals, families and couples looking to transform their lives. I strongly believe that each difficult situation we experience is an opportunity for personal growth, and to live a more fulfilling and joyful existence.
I obtained both, my Bachelor's in Psychology and Master's in Mental Health Counseling degrees from Argosy University School of Professional Psychology in February 2007. I completed my internship at a domestic violence shelter, where I received specialized domestic violence training. During this time, I provided individual and family counseling to victims/survivors and their families, and also facilitated support groups for the victims. For 7 years I provided therapeutic services to children and families from a variety of cultural backgrounds. I served as Clinical Supervisor for a residential program offering mental health services to migrant children from Central America, while also providing them with counseling and psychoeducational groups. I also provided therapeutic services to children and adults of sexual abuse. I understand that counseling can sometimes feel intimidating, that’s why I offer a comfortable, supportive and non-judgmental environment.
